Color Palette Generator

Generate harmonious color palettes from a base color. Create complementary, analogous, triadic, and monochromatic palettes with HEX, RGB, and HSL values.

Used 5.2K times today

Color Palette Generator

#f55a89
Click to copy
#e5c29e
Click to copy
#0afdd8
Click to copy
#07c74b
Click to copy
#6cae1c
Click to copy
#F55A89
#E5C29E
#0AFDD8
#07C74B
#6CAE1C
Lock colors you want to keep, then click Generate to regenerate the rest.

How to Use Color Palette Generator

  1. 1

    Pick a base color

    Use the color picker or enter a HEX value to choose your starting color.

  2. 2

    Select a harmony type

    Choose complementary (opposite on the color wheel), analogous (adjacent), triadic (three equidistant), split-complementary, or monochromatic (same hue, varying lightness).

  3. 3

    Copy your palette

    Click any swatch to copy its HEX code, or export the full palette as a CSS variables block or JSON object.

Frequently Asked Questions

What is color harmony?
Color harmony refers to the principle that certain color combinations are naturally pleasing to the eye based on their positions on the color wheel. Complementary, analogous, and triadic combinations are common examples.
How many colors does each palette type generate?
Complementary generates 2 colors, analogous generates 3, triadic generates 3, split-complementary generates 3, and monochromatic generates 5 tints and shades of the base color.
Can I use these palettes in commercial projects?
Absolutely. Color combinations are not copyrightable. The generated HEX, RGB, and HSL values are yours to use in any personal or commercial project freely.

About Color Palette Generator

The Color Palette Generator on Utilko uses color theory to produce harmonious palettes from any base color you choose. Whether you are designing a brand identity, choosing a website color scheme, or selecting UI accent colors, starting with a color-theory-based palette ensures your colors work well together.

Generate multiple harmony types, preview all colors with their codes, and export the palette as CSS custom properties or JSON for direct use in your design system. All processing is instant and runs entirely in your browser.

More Miscellaneous Tools